McGinnis in 1911 Ireland
The 1911 Census recorded 273 people named McGinnis in Ireland; roughly one in every 16,000 people carried the name. The name was split fairly evenly between men and women: 147 men and 125 women. (A small number, 1, had no sex recorded.)
Counties with McGinnis in Ireland
The McGinnises were heavily concentrated in Derry, home to 53.5% of them (146 people). Next came Antrim (30), Armagh (27), Donegal (18) and Tyrone (18).

McGinnis average age in 1911
The average McGinnis in 1911 was 30.4 years old, 31.7 for men and 29.0 for women; almost exactly in line with the national averages of 29.6 for men and 30.5 for women. That low figure reflects just how many children there were in Edwardian Ireland, along with high infant mortality and the limits of public health at the time. For comparison, average life expectancy in Ireland today is around 83.
McGinnis literacy in 1911
Of the McGinnises whose literacy was recorded, 76.6% could both read and write, 3.1% could read but not write, and 20.3% could do neither. The figures were much the same for men and women. Bear in mind these figures include young children; the census itself only counted people aged nine and over when calculating illiteracy, on the grounds that it was unfair to label a child illiterate before they'd had a chance to learn.
McGinnis common first names
The most common male names were James (20), John, William, Joseph and Patrick. For women it was Mary (14), followed by Jane, Annie, Catherine and Maggie.
McGinnis occupations in 1911
The most common entry on a McGinnis's census form was "Scholar"; 20.1% (55) were children at school. Among the rest, the most common occupations were farmer (14.7%), farm labourer (7%), general labourer (5.1%) and textile worker (5.1%). Grouped by sector, agriculture accounted for 22% of all McGinnises, followed by textiles & clothing, domestic service and general labourers.
What religion is McGinnis?
McGinnises were predominantly Roman Catholic (80.6%). The remainder were mostly Presbyterian (12.1%), Anglican (5.5%) and Non-Conformist (1.5%).
